Contemporary adult bunk beds come in different styles that accommodate different tastes and requirements. Here are some popular choices:
1. Loft Beds
Loft beds are elevated beds that leave the lower space open for other usages. This design is fantastic for optimizing space because you can turn the area into a desk, a seating nook, or storage.
2.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
These beds configure in an "L" shape, allowing for more floor space. They can frequently consist of additional functions like bookshelves or drawers, making them practical in addition to elegant.
3. Triple Bunk Beds
For those with larger households or frequent guests, triple bunk beds allow three sleeping spaces in one compact design. This option is particularly beneficial for holiday homes.
4. Full over Full Bunk Beds
These beds permit adults to sleep easily on both bunk levels. They typically have a sturdy style to make sure security and comfort.
5. Customized Designs
Some producers offer custom-made bunk beds to fulfill particular height and storage requirements, guaranteeing that space is enhanced according to specific preferences.

What is the weight limitation for adult size bunk beds?
A lot of adult size bunk beds can support anywhere from 200 to 600 pounds per bed, depending on the materials and construction. Constantly examine the maker's requirements.
2. Are adult size bunk beds comfy for nightly use?
Yes! Many adult size bunk beds are created for comfort, featuring thick mattresses and ergonomic styles. Complete over full setups often supply sufficient space for adults.
3. Can adult size bunk beds be taken apart and moved?
Most modern bunk beds can be taken apart and reassembled for easy relocation. Examine the manufacturer's guidelines to understand the assembly process.
4. What products are best for adult size bunk beds?
Strong wood, metal, and composite materials are popular options. Strong wood is applauded for sturdiness, while metal frequently provides a more modern-day aesthetic.
5. How do I pick the ideal size of bunk bed for my space?
Procedure the space dimensions, including ceiling height, to guarantee sufficient headroom on the top bunk. Consider the space needed for motion around the furnishings.
